#A09CFC Color
#A09CFC is rgb(160, 156, 252) in RGB, hsl(242, 94%, 80%) in HSL, and about cmyk(37%, 38%, 0%, 1%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Perano (Infinitely Hot) (#94B1FF), visibly different at ΔE 15.63. Black text is the more readable choice on this background.

#A09CFC Channel Values
How #A09CFC bre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 160 · G 156 · B 252 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 242° · S 94% · L 80%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 242° · S 38% · V 99%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 37% · M 38% · Y 0% · K 1%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 2.43:1 vs white · 8.66: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|

#A09CFC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#A09CFC?
#A09CFC is a lightest blue — rgb(160, 156, 252) in RGB and hsl(242, 94%, 80%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Perano (Infinitely Hot) (#94B1FF), which is visibly different at a CIE76 distance of 15.63.
What is the RGB value of #A09CFC?
#A09CFC is rgb(160, 156, 252) — red 160, green 156, and blue 252 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#A09CFC?
#A09CFC converts to approximately cmyk(37%, 38%, 0%, 1%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#A09CFC be black or white?
Black text is the more readable choice. #A09CFC scores 2.43:1 against white and 8.66: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#A09CFC as a CSS color keyword?
No. #A09CFC is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is cornflowerblue (#6495ED) at a CIE76 distance of 16.86, which is visibly different.
